Tampa Bay Rays Preview
The Tampa Bay Rays have a 14-16 record this season and are sitting in third place in the AL East. The Rays have a 9-12 home record and are 11-17 in over/under. They are coming off a 0-3 home defeat by the Royals and are 5-2 in their last 7 games. Under is 5-0 in their last 5 games. The Rays have a .248 batting average this season, a .316 OBP, and a .382 slugging percentage. Tampa’s pitching staff has a 3.42 ERA and 1.15 WHIP. Yandy Diaz leads the Rays with 31 hits and 13 RBI, while Brandon Lowe leads the team in RBI with 15, and Jonathan Aranda is the team’s best hitter with a .299 batting average.
Shane Baz (R) will take the mound for the Rays, and he has a 3-0 record, 2.45 ERA, and 0.99 WHIP. He is coming off a shutout start against the Padres with zero earned runs in 7 innings pitched. This will be his first start against the Royals in his career.
Kansas City Royals Preview
The Kansas City Royals have a 16-15 record this season and are sitting in third place in the AL Central. The Royals have a 5-10 road record and are 10-20 in over/under. They are coming off a 3-0 road victory over the Rays, and have been red-hot lately, with an 8-1 record in their last 9 games. Under is 5-1 in their last 6 games. The Royals have a .228 batting average this season, a .290 OBP, and a .328 Slugging percentage. Kansas’ pitching staff has a 3.20 ERA and 1.21 WHIP. Bobby Witt Jr leads the Royals with 38 hits, and he is the team’s best hitter with a .322 batting average. Vinnie Pasquantino leads the team in RBI with 18, adding a team-high 4 home runs.
Seth Lugo (R) will take the mound for the Royals, and he has a 2-3 record, 3.08 ERA, and 1.08 WHIP. He has been significantly worse on the road, with a 4.73 road ERA, but he is coming off a shutout start against the Astros with zero earned runs in 8 innings pitched. He has been terrific against the Rays in his career, with just two earned runs in 13.1 innings pitched in two starts.

Kansas City Royals vs Tampa Bay Rays Prediction
The Royals have won both meetings against the Rays this season, with a combined 6-1 score. They are 6-3 in their last 9 meetings against the Rays, and under is 5-1 in their last 6 meetings.
In this Kansas City Royals vs Tampa Bay Rays Prediction, the Rays are coming as -165 home favorites. This line makes no sense, as the Rays are facing the hottest team in the MLB right now and have looked terrible in the first two games of the series. Both starting pitchers have been looking great so far, and as much as I am tempted to side with the underdog in this game, the value lies in the total. Both teams combined for 4 and 3 runs in the first two games of this series; they both have top-8 bullpen ERA’s and both pitchers have a combined 5.53 ERA and are both coming off shutout performances.
The total for this game is set at 8 runs, and there is no way we are going to see 9 runs in this game, when both teams are averaging just 7.1 combined. Take the under 8 runs.
